Based on the passage below, match each researcher's model or group's framework (Left Column) with the author's attitude or tone toward it (Right Column).

Passage:
Classical glaciology maintained that the basal motion of the East Antarctic Ice Sheet was governed strictly by thermal conduction at the bedrock interface. However, Dr. Julian Vance’s recent subglacial hydrological model proposes that transient subglacial lake drainage events trigger rapid, localized ice-stream acceleration. While several numerical modelers dismiss Vance's hypothesis as an artifact of over-parameterized friction coefficients, the author emphasizes that his incorporation of synthetic aperture radar interferometry provides crucial empirical verification that cannot be easily discounted. Conversely, Dr. Karen Lindqvist’s rival theory attributes ice-stream acceleration primarily to geothermal heat anomalies along subglacial rift zones. The author views Lindqvist’s position as unsustainable and evidence-deficient, as deep-drilling thermal probes have consistently failed to detect the expected thermal fluxes. Finally, the integrative ice-bed coupling model proposed by the Polar Dynamic Assessment Group—which attempts to blend basal hydrology with geothermal forcing into a single predictive framework—is characterized by the author as a conceptually valuable, though currently overambitious, step toward holistic ice-sheet modeling.

  • Dr. Julian Vance's subglacial hydrological modelQualified endorsement defending its empirical foundation against skeptics
  • Dr. Karen Lindqvist's geothermal heat anomaly theoryDirect rejection based on contradictory physical data
  • The Polar Dynamic Assessment Group's integrative ice-bed coupling modelMeasured approval recognizing its conceptual merit while noting its present overreach

Dr. Julian Vance's model matches qualified endorsement defending its empirical foundation; Dr. Karen Lindqvist's theory matches direct rejection based on contradictory physical data; and the Polar Dynamic Assessment Group's model matches measured approval recognizing its conceptual merit while noting its present overreach.
The correct pairings accurately reflect the author's distinct tone toward each perspective in the passage: defending Vance's model against critics with empirical evidence, rejecting Lindqvist's theory due to contradictory probe data, and offering measured, qualified praise for the Polar Dynamic Assessment Group's integrative model.

Analyze the author's stance toward Dr. Julian Vance's subglacial hydrological model.
The author acknowledges criticism from numerical modelers but pushes back, stating Vance's radar data provides crucial empirical verification. This represents a qualified endorsement that defends the model against critics.
Tracking how the author responds to opposing viewpoints reveals whether the author endorses or rejects a theory.
2
Evaluate the author's stance toward Dr. Karen Lindqvist's geothermal heat anomaly theory.
The author explicitly labels the theory as 'unsustainable and evidence-deficient' due to negative findings from thermal probes. This indicates direct rejection grounded in empirical contradiction.
Descriptive adjectives such as 'unsustainable' and 'evidence-deficient' signal explicit disapproval and rejection.
3
Assess the author's stance toward the Polar Dynamic Assessment Group's integrative framework.
The author calls the framework 'conceptually valuable' but 'currently overambitious,' combining praise for its core idea with caution about its practicality.
Nuanced expressions combining positive descriptors ('conceptually valuable') with caveats ('currently overambitious') indicate measured, balanced approval.
